If you time everything to happen in the lead engine just a couple of degrees ahead of the other (if coupled at the crank), each power plant can act on it's own and the lead engine will always tend to keep the coupling tight, even if it makes far less power but can keep up with the revs.
A crank coupling with no ability to have just a little flex will cause a lot of problems to be transmitted to the other.
